New Delhi, April 25: Success also continued at the South Asian Junior and Cadet Table Tennis Championships, held at Maldives, as Team India made a complete sweep of gold in team and singles events, apart from grabbing a few silver medals.
In all, India won 12 gold and four silver medals.
This regional competition, held for the first time in Maldives, saw participation of India, Sri Lanka, Pakistan, Bangladesh, Nepal and Maldives.
The Manav Thakkar-led team in Junior Boys in the company of Manush Shah and Jeet Chandra won the team gold even as Manav accounted for singles gold in what was an Indian affair as Jeet had to satisfy with the silver medal. Manav, the world No. 2, won his third gold medal when he paired up with Manush Shah in the doubles.
In Junior Girls, Archana Kamal along with Yashini Sivashankar won the team gold and then combined with Selenadeepthi Selvakumar to win doubles gold in the same section.
The Indians also grabbed Cadet Boys and Cadet Girls team gold medals apart from singles as Dev Shroff and Trisha Gogoi executed their plans well. Even the Hopes boys and girls singles gold also came the India ways when Suresh Raj Preyesh and Suhana Saini beat their Pakistani and Maldives opponents, respectively, in the finals.
A.S. Kelr was the chief referee of the three-day competitions held at Male.
